We just celebrated Valentine’s Day … a day when flowers and chocolate become the foremost things we think of for our honeys.  Did you know that Valentine’s Day is the busiest day of the year for florists, followed closely by Mother’s Day?  Did you also know that florists make 1/3 of their annual income on Valentine’s Day flowers?

Just a bit of trivia for you … I used to be in the floral business and those two holidays alone were actual nightmares for me, just because I wanted to make sure everyone got their flowers on time, the arrangements were what they expected, and that everyone was happy.  A lot of prep work, a lot of scheduling of deliveries, and a lot of smiles to all the walk ins who needed something dazzling at the last minute.  Needless to say, I needed more than chocolates at the end of the day and I didn’t care to see another single flower!!!  But, in the end, it was worth it because I provided a service that brought joy and happiness to others.
